Gustave Courbet (1819–1877), the self-proclaimed "proudest and most arrogant man in France," created a sensation at the Salon of 1850–51 when he exhibited a group of paintings set in his native Ornans, a village in eastern France. This is the first painting in which Courbet announced his project of presenting particular observations of provincial life on a scale and with a sense of importance commensurate with that of academic history painting. The After Dinner and the Stonebreakers are the first in a series of large multifigure compositions--others are the Burial at Ornans and the Peasants of Flagey Returning from the Fair —that mark not only Courbet's maturity as an artist but his emergence as a disruptive force, almost a one-man wrecking crew, in the cultural politics of his time. meeting with the artist, when he was taken to his studio by Champfleury in the winter of 1848. Courbet (1819-77): the After Dinner at Ornans, perhaps begun in the small town of the title (the artist's birthplace) but certainly completed in Paris during the winter of 1848-49; and the Stonebreakers, painted wholly in Ornans just under a year later. After Dinner at Ornans. Exhibited at the 1849 Salon, After Dinner at Ornans is set around a table in Caravaggesque fashion. This genre scene of imposing dimensions testifies to the debt Courbet owed to an entire tradition of realistic French painting, from the Le Nain brothers to Chardin. At the Salon of 1849 Courbet received a gold medal for After Dinner at Ornans (Palais des Beaux-Arts, Lille), a work that launched an unprecedented series of paintings depicting life in Ornans. It shows Courbet's father, Régis, to the left, along with three regular visitors to the household: Urbain Cuenot in the background, propped on his elbow, Adolphe Marlet with his back turned and lighting a pipe, and Alphonse Promayet playing his instrument.
